qnx6.5 app自启动操作

来源:互联网 发布:java高级培训 编辑:程序博客网 时间:2024/05/02 00:47

关于自己写一个程序(比如程序名为yd)自启动方法:

a:用开发工具编译一个二进制可执行文件yd

b:把二进制文件放入文件系统添加进文件系统中(添加binaries),如下图:

      说明: cid:image003.png@01CF178C.D7AF6490说明: cid:image003.png@01CF178C.D7AF6490

c:创建一个sh脚本并添加到binaries中,sh示例可参考附件。

d:在bsh文件中添加其启动,如下黄色部分是添加内容,这样就可以了。

display_msg "---> Starting /etc/rc.d/rc.local"

# /etc/rc.d/rc.local

display_msg "---> Starting run.sh"

sh /bin/run.sh

# Start some extra shells on other consoles

reopen /dev/con2



sh文件

#!/bin/sh 
a="hello world" 
echo "A is:" 
echo $a
/proc/boot/yd
vm

0 0